            HJC lid HJC IS-16 SCRATCH FULL FACE HELMET arrived yesterday.

            My head size is 58 and ordered L. It fits fine, but looks big on the head though. Its got a nice adjustable sun visor and lot of vents. All in all happy.

            Cost of helmet including shipping and duty turned out to be 11K. Have clicked some pics at night but they aren't any good so just posting a pic off the net
